REVIEW
Rating: ☆☆☆☆
Aspiring writer Klara has a case of writer's block so when her favourite author is in town to teach a writer's workshop she is first in line to sign up. Chris is the male erotica author in question, who has muse in each city he has visited. He also doesn't believe in love.
When a stranger prevents her from executing her plan to get to know a fellow runner better, she is astonished to discover that he is in fact her favourite author. As they spend time together because of the chemistry between them, they become each other's muse for the time he is there.
Klara was certainly sassy and Chris determined and motivating. I am going to be honest and say that I didn't find this hilariously funny. I, unfortunately, only found it mildly funny in places. This could be down to my own (lack of) of sense of humour but I only found myself smiling at some of their antics. I still found it an enjoyable read.
